The third annual Futures Worth Fighting For Telethon is Thursday, August 17th. ABC30 and Valley Children's Hospital are teaming up for the event. Viewers and followers will be encouraged to make a donation to Valley Children's Hospital. You just need to pick up your phone.

The hospital located in Madera County is the only one of its kind between Northern and Southern California. Action News anchor Tony Cabrera will kick off the telethon at 5 a.m. and the station will broadcast live reports and cut-ins throughout the day.

The telethon includes special stories about the patients, doctors, staff, and families impacted by Valley Children's. Donors are encouraged to text the word GEORGE to 80077 or call 1-877-353-0000. The telethon ends 8 p.m. Thursday. Valley Children's Hospital is a nonprofit, state-of-the-art children's hospital on a 50-acre campus.

It has a medical staff of more than 550 physicians. With 356 licensed beds, Valley Children's Hospital is one of the largest hospitals of its type in the nation.
